Beer House, Restaurant and pub in Florianska Street, Krakow, Poland.
Beer House is a restaurant and pub on Florianska Street in central Krakow, Poland, spread across two floors. It offers around twenty taps and over two hundred bottled beers from both local and international breweries.
Florianska Street, where the venue stands, has been one of Krakow's main trading routes since the medieval period, linking the Market Square to the city gate. The building sits in a district that remained a key commercial area for centuries.
The Beer House works with Polish breweries to bring in regional styles that are hard to find elsewhere in the city. Browsing the menu feels like a small tour of the country's brewing regions.
The venue is on Florianska Street, a well-known pedestrian route close to the Main Square, so it is easy to find on foot. Booking ahead is a good idea, especially on evenings and weekends when it tends to fill up.
The basement is fitted with cooling systems that keep different beer styles at separate temperatures before serving. This means a wheat beer and a stout on the same table are stored and served under very different conditions.
